You'd have to think that Braverman ought to have just about peaked with that total. There are a lot of dim Tory MPs, but there surely can't be too many who are seriously dim enough to think she would make a competent PM. Zahawi too much baggage with the current offshore investigations (and questions about offshoring may do for Sunak as well).

Surprised that Hunt was booted at the first round because he always seemed one of the more reasonable candidates. Probably too reasonable for Tory MPs, or perhaps he's just not curried favour with enough of them?

I suppose Tugendhat is the 'reasonable' candidate along with Mordaunt - noticeable that neither has much of a record of doing anything in government so they aren't linked with failure yet.

I think the Tory MPs see any women candidates as potential vote-winners, because they can make a lot of noise about Labour never having a female leader. You'd have to think this is why so many utterly unsuitable female candidates are in the race, despite the fact that Tory MPs have a 4:1 male/female ratio.

It would be interesting to see how the Tory membership voted if given the choice between a white and a non-white candidate.
Suspect we might not have the opportunity to find out this time if they try and stitch up Sunak. The fact that the Daily Heil is so much against him indicates something.
